98 blazer won't shift out of first gear until I let up on gas

Could be throttle valve within the throttle body has gunked up and is catching the decent cable. Try changing tranny fluid & filter.
It can be the cause of many problems like that in transmissions.
Gives a false reading on the throttle position sensor causing irregular shifting.

Blazer has first and second gear but won't shift

You have a shift solenoid sticking its located in the valvebody.Pull the transmission pan off and you will the solenoids in the back of the valvebody they will have wires hooked to them.Replace the bad solenoid and the filter.
